anyone else's or anyone elses'?
Kate's reading is better than ____in the class.
A. anyone's
B. anyone else's
C. anyone elses'
D. any other one
Plz help me to choose the answer, which one is right and why?

The right answer is B : anyone else's.
'Else' has no plural form.
[NB Andrew is wrong about 'anyone else'. The subject of sentence is 'Kate's reading', not 'Kate'.]
